What Casues Muscular Pains In Neck And Upper Arms?

Question: I'm experiencing muscular pains in my neck and upper arms. I suffer some arthritis but this is different. the pain occasionally extends to my fingers, as if I had strained enormously. What could it be?

Brief Answer:
it looks to me cervical spondylitis

Detailed Answer:
Hello Madam,
It looks to me that you are having cervical spondylitis. In this there is pinching nerve in neck which cause pain in shoulder with tingling and numbness in hand.Nature of pain can be from muscular to cramp like. Pain occurs more in night time specially in lying down position.
To confirm the diagnosis you have to get MRI of the neck. I would also advice you to get blood sugar test and serum B 12 estimation.
Till you get these investigations I would suggest you following :
1. Soft cervical collar
2. Tablet pregabalin M after discussing with your doctor.
3. Physiotherapy for example - cervical traction and neck muscle strengthening exercises.
